Registering your trip with the Norway embassy is crucial for ensuring safety, effective communication, and access to support during emergencies. In case of natural disasters such as earthquakes or floods, having your travel information on file enables the embassy to provide timely updates and assistance. For travelers caught in political unrest, the embassy can offer evacuation guidance and advice on safe routes. Additionally, in the event of a medical emergency, registration ensures that the embassy can quickly reach out to you or assist in coordinating medical care. Overall, trip registration enhances your security while abroad and strengthens the embassy’s ability to aid Norwegians in distress.
Can the Norway embassy assist in legal issues abroad?
Yes, the Norway embassy can assist with legal issues by providing guidance, suggesting local legal representation, and offering information about local laws and processes.
What should I do if I lose my Norway passport in Mongolia?
If you lose your passport, report the loss to the local police and contact the Norway embassy in Mongolia immediately for assistance in obtaining a replacement passport and to discuss your options.
Does the Norway embassy provide information on local customs and laws?
Yes, the embassy can provide information on local customs, laws, and regulations to help you navigate your stay in Mongolia smoothly.
Can the embassy help find medical facilities if needed?
Yes, the Norway embassy can assist in finding medical facilities, recommend local healthcare providers, and help facilitate communication if you’re unwell.
